      Is Yervoy approved for use on stage III patients, or is it only being used in trials for stage III?  It doesn't seem like there is much available for stage III…

          No, the FDA has yet to approve Yervoy for Stage III treatment.  Interferon is the only FDA-approved treatment.  As a 9-year IIIc survivor who did a trial, I'd highly recommend checking into your clinical trial options.  Best wishes.
